ZIELINSKY, Mônica. The creation of Romy Pocztaruk: Transversalities between memory, nostalgia and criticism. Estúdio [online]. 2021, vol.12, n.33, pp.155-167.  Epub Mar 31, 2021. ISSN 1647-6158.

Through her thought-provoking work, South Brazilian artist Romy Pocztaruk (1983) opens meaningful horizons to rethink artistic paths related to cultural history and physical boundaries, fictitious or not. Both perspectives approach the ways erasures are found in different cultures while dealing with memory in art. In two different phenomena, in a moment between the production of these works, they emphatically expose issues of temporality or space categories addressed by the artist in her contemporary art creation.

Keywords : memory in art; art and temporality; art and space; Romy Pocztaruk.
